Soft Pumpkin Cookies with Cinnamon Frosting Recipe
Soft and delicious pumpkin cookies topped with a flavorful cinnamon frosting. These cookies are perfect for fall gatherings, holiday parties, or just a cozy night in.

Cookies:
- 1/2 cup vegan butter, softened
- 1/4 cup pumpkin puree
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ice
- 2 teaspoons cornstarch
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
Cinnamon Frosting:
- 1 cup vegan butter, softened
- 3 teaspoons vanilla paste (or extract)
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ice (or cinnamon)
- 1/3 cup brown sugar
- 3 1/4 cups powdered sugar
- Cookies: In a stand mixer or large bowl, cream together the softened butter, pumpkin puree, brown sugar, granulated sugar, and vanilla until the mixture is light and fluffy.
- In a separate large b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, pumpkin pie spice, cornstarch, and salt.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ients bowl, mixing on low speed until just combined (don’t over-mix).
- Cover the bowl and place it in the fridge for 30 minutes or overnight. Chilling the dough is an important step that you cannot skip.
- Preheat the oven to 350 °F (177 °C).
- Scoop 2-inch balls of dough out with a medium cookie scooper or a large spoon. Press down to flatten the dough balls into disks. While baking, the dough will not spread out much so you need to form it into a cookie shape beforehand. Arrange them a couple of inches apart on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
- Bake on the center rack for 10-12 minutes. Let them cool down completely on the baking sheet.
- Cinnamon Frosting: In a medium bowl, use an electric mixer or a stand mixer with the whisk attachment to whip together all the ingredients until fully combined. If preparing in advance, c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ate until ready to use.
- Spoon icing into a piping bag fitted with the Wilton Piping Tip #2A. Pipe the cinnamon frosting on top of the cooled cookies in a swirl, starting from the middle and moving outwards. Sprinkle pumpkin pie spice on top, and enjoy!
Notes
- For a festive touch, top the cookies with a sprinkle of edible gold dust or crushed nuts.
- Store leftover c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
